
Mullah Ahmadullah Zahid
Mullah Ahmadullah Zahid is the Deputy Minister of Industry and Commerce for Afghanistan, known for his role in facilitating trade agreements between Afghanistan and neighboring countries. Recently, he was in the news for signing an Early Harvest Programme with Pakistan aimed at reducing tariffs on key agricultural exports, marking a significant step towards a broader preferential trade agreement between the two nations.
